Jahangirnagar University, Sept 17 (UNB) – A seminar titled ‘Basics and Research Trends in Fibre Optic Communication System’ was held at Jahangirnagar University (JU) on Monday.

The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ers (IEEE) of JU student unit organised the seminar at the seminar room of Zahir Raihan auditorium. 

Professor of University of Yamanashi, Japan Dr Masanori Hanawa delivered the keynote speech on the topics.

In his speech, he inspired the participants to pursue higher study in Japan.

Presided over by Associate Professor of JU Institute of Information Technology (IIT) M Mesbah Uddin Sarker, the seminar was also addressed by Associate Professor Dr M Shamim Kaiser, Associate Professor Dr Md Whaiduzzaman and Assistant Professor Shamim Al Mamun.

Over 100 students of different departments and institutes took part in the programme.
